POLICE are mounting extra patrols this weekend to ensure people follow the new restrictions.  

Swindon entered Tier 2 along the majority of the country on Wednesday.  

New coronavirus restrictions have been put in place to help reduce the spread of coronavirus. 

A Wiltshire Police spokesperson said: “We are urging everyone to ensure they fully understand the current restrictions.  

“We will have extra officers on patrol across the weekend to ensure our communities understand the restrictions and are adhering to them.” 

The Government has outlined the following: 

• Nightclubs and adult entertainment venues must remain closed. 

• Pubs and bars may not provide alcohol for consumption on the premises, unless with a substantial meal, so they are operating as a restaurant. They may remain open for take-away services. 

• Hospitality venues must stop taking orders after 10pm and must close between 11pm and 5am. 

• You can only meet socially with friends or family indoors who you either live with or have formed a support bubble with. This means you cannot visit other houses (unless they are in your support bubble) and you cannot meet others in a pub or restaurant. 

• If you are meeting outdoors, which includes a private garden or other outdoor space, the rule of six applies. The limit of six includes children of any age. You can meet in a group larger than six if you are all from the same household or support bubble or another legal exemption applies.
